Eritrea got independence from:
Correct answer: A. Ethiopia
- A. Ethiopia
- B. U.K
- C. Spain
- D. Soviet Union
Explanation
Eritrea became independent from Ethiopia after a long armed struggle, with independence formally recognized in 1993. British, Spanish, and Soviet rule were not the source of Eritrea’s immediate independence in this context.
